As the Senior Manager, Product Design at Ingram Micro, you will play a pivotal role in shaping the user experience for our digital platforms and products. You will lead a team of talented product designers and collaborate closely with cross-functional stakeholders to deliver intuitive, user-centered designs that enhance customer satisfaction and drive business growth. This is an excellent opportunity for an experienced UX professional to make a significant impact and contribute to the evolution of Ingram Micro's digital ecosystem.If you are passionate about creating exceptional user experiences and want to contribute to a global technology leader, we would love to hear from you. Your role:


  • Lead and manage a team of product designers, providing mentorship, guidance, and support to foster their growth and professional development.

  • Define the overall UX strategy and vision, aligning it with business objectives and ensuring a seamless user experience across all digital touchpoints.

  • Collaborate with product managers, engineers, and other stakeholders to understand business requirements and translate them into innovative, user-centered design solutions.

  • Conduct user research, usability testing, and gather feedback to inform design decisions and validate assumptions.

  • Develop and maintain design standards, guidelines, and style guides to ensure consistency and adherence to best practices.

  • Stay up to date with industry trends, emerging technologies, and UX best practices, and incorporate them into the design process.

  • Champion a user-centered design approach within the organization, advocating for the importance of UX and driving a customer-centric culture.

  • Collaborate with cross-functional teams to define and track UX metrics and key performance indicators (KPIs) to measure the success and impact of design initiatives.

  • Collaborate with external design agencies or contractors when necessary, managing the relationship and ensuring high-quality deliverables.

  • Continuously iterate and improve on design solutions based on user feedback, data analysis, and business goals.

  • Roll up your sleeves and contribute as a strategist and designer when necessary.

What you bring to the role:

  • Bachelor's degree in design, human-computer interaction (HCI), or a related field required. Master's degree preferred.

  • Managers at this level typically have 8 + years of functional experience, including a minimum of 5 years position specific experience.

  • Mastery over product design with the ability to make significant contributions to the company.

  • Proven experience as a product design manager or lead designer, preferably managing through subordinate managers. The successful manager will have experience leading UX teams and delivering high-quality design solutions.

  • Strong portfolio demonstrating a deep understanding of UX principles, interaction design, and visual design, with a focus on digital products and platforms.

  • Proficient with design and prototyping tools such as Sketch, Adobe Creative Suite, Figma, or similar.

  • Experience with user research methodologies, usability testing, and gathering user feedback to inform design decisions.

  • Strong strategic thinking and ability to align UX strategies with business objectives.

  • Excellent communication and collaboration skills, with the ability to influence and build relationships with stakeholders at all levels of the organization.

  • Familiarity with Agile methodologies and ability to work in a fast-paced, iterative development environment.

  • Strong analytical skills and data-driven mindset, with the ability to leverage metrics to measure the impact of design initiatives.

  • Passion for emerging technologies, industry trends, and continuous learning in the field of UX design

  • Nice to have: Experience working on complex, B2B SaaS products.

The typical base pay range for this role in Irvine, California is USD $116,600 - $157,400 - $198,200 per year.The ranges above reflect the potential annual base pay across the U.S. for all roles; the applicable base pay range will depend on the candidate's primary work location, pay grade, and variable compensation plan. Individual base pay within each range depends on various factors, in addition to primary work location, such as complexity and responsibility of role, job duties/requirements, and relevant experience and skills. Base pay ranges are reviewed and typically updated each year. Offers are made within the base pay range applicable at the time of hire. New hires starting base pay generally falls in the bottom half (between the minimum and midpoint) of a pay range.At Ingram Micro certain roles are eligible for additional rewards, including merit increases, annual bonus or sales incentives and long-term incentives.
